Expansion Strategies Behind Spirit Airlines’ International Network Growth

Spirit Airlines is strategically positioning itself to capitalize on the high-demand international routes that connect the United States with Central and South America. This decision is rooted in a meticulous analysis of passenger trends, market demands, and competitive pricing structures that guide which destinations would yield the highest returns. As part of its expansion, Spirit is focusing on affordable travel options while enhancing its service offerings in key markets such as:

  • Mexico
  • Guatemala
  • Honduras
  • Colombia
  • Costa Rica

By integrating these countries into its flight network, Spirit not only appeals to budget-conscious travelers but also fosters cultural exchanges and tourism growth in both directions. The airline’s strategy encompasses a dynamic promotional schedule, targeting seasonal travelers and connecting underserved markets with vital air service. Notably, agent partnerships and community engagement initiatives play a crucial role in boosting awareness and facilitating seamless travel experiences for passengers. The expansion strategy is expected to reflect in a substantial increase in passenger volume and revenue by 2025, setting Spirit Airlines on a trajectory of impressive growth.

Market Insights on Travel Demand in the US-Mexico-Central America Corridor

The travel landscape within the US-Mexico-Central America corridor is evolving rapidly, driven by a surge in demand for travel options. In recent years, key trends have emerged that highlight the increasing preference for international travel among US citizens. Notably, the growth in frugal travel options has propelled destinations like Mexico, Guatemala, Honduras, Colombia, and Costa Rica into the spotlight. Factors contributing to this robust demand include:

  • Cost-effective flights: Affordable air travel has made it easier for travelers to explore these regions.
  • Cultural proximity: The close cultural and historical ties between these countries enhance the travel experience.
  • Adventure tourism: There is a rising interest in experiences ranging from beach getaways to eco-tourism.

As airlines, particularly Spirit Airlines, expand their reach into these markets, they are strategically positioned to capitalize on this growing demand. New routes provide travelers with unprecedented access to a diverse array of destinations, thus trumpeting an era of connectivity. The following table illustrates the projected growth in passenger volumes for the upcoming year, underscoring the significance of these routes:

Destination Projected Passenger Growth (%)
Mexico 20%
Guatemala 15%
Honduras 18%
Colombia 22%
Costa Rica 25%

With these figures, it is clear why there is a buzz surrounding travel in this corridor. As the sector gears up for explosive growth in 2025, stakeholders in the travel industry must reinforce their strategies to better serve the evolving needs of travelers seeking adventures across the vibrant landscapes of Central America and beyond.
